  4. What are the alternatives to Latanoprost for treating glaucoma?
    Latanoprost belongs to the prostaglandin analog class. Alternatives with similar mechanisms include Bimatoprost (Lumigan), Travoprost (Travatan), and Tafluprost (Taflotan). These medications also lower intraocular pressure by increasing uveoscleral outflow. For patients seeking non-prostaglandin options, beta-blockers (Timolol), carbonic anhydrase inhibitors (Dorzolamide), or alpha agonists (Brimonidine) may be prescribed. Your eye care specialist will recommend the best alternative based on your condition and tolerance.

  10. Is Latanoprost right for me?
    Latanoprost’s suitability depends on your specific condition and health profile. For glaucoma patients, it is highly effective in reducing intraocular pressure with once-daily dosing. However, those with a history of macular edema, eye inflammation, or dark pigmentation changes may need alternatives. Patients using contact lenses should wait 15 minutes after application to avoid lens contamination. For cosmetic use, consult a dermatologist to assess risks like periorbital skin darkening.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should avoid Latanoprost due to limited safety data. Always discuss contraindications, drug interactions (e.G. thyroid medications), and side effects (e.G. redness, itching) with your doctor before starting treatment. Regular eye exams are essential to monitor efficacy and adjust therapy as needed.
